In simple words he explained to me what is a split level house. It is basically a multiple-story house where the living space is connected by a short set of stairs.

What is the design idea of a split level house?The split level house design ideas are having three different levels with a living room on the main floor, bedrooms, bathrooms and a kitchen on the upper floor and it also has a garage in the basement. It is also called as bi-level home or tri-level home and the floor levels are staggered in such houses.
Why do people build split-level houses?Split level houses are budget-friendly, trendy and perfect for small area plots and are mostly found in suburbs. It looks elegant if planned creatively and so people often built such houses.
What are the disadvantages of a split level house?Few disadvantages of a split level house are:
The stairs restrict people’s mobility
Remodelling gets very tough for such houses
You won’t be able to attract a lot of people if you want to sell it
They are expensive to built
